Majority believe William will strip Harry and Meghan's titles, poll suggests

A new poll has revealed that a significant majority of readers believe Prince William will strip Prince Harry and Meghan Markle of their royal titles when he becomes King. The survey, conducted by the Daily Mirror, asked readers whether they thought the Duke of Cambridge would take such a step, with 9,806 respondents saying yes and only 1,203 saying no.

The debate comes amid ongoing criticism of Harry's contradictory stance, with commentators noting that he has expressed a desire to step away from royal duties while continuing to hold onto his Sussex title, HRH style, and royal titles for his children. Some readers argued that this undermines the value of royal titles and called for decisive action.

One commenter, Questioning, said that Prince and Princess titles should only apply to the children of the monarch and direct heirs, suggesting that Beatrice and Eugenie should not hold them any more than Archie and Lilibet. Another reader, Guinevere, argued that Harry and his children should be removed from the line of succession altogether, stating that he has proved himself unworthy of a public role.

Others felt that King Charles should act now, with Cynicaloap remarking that Harry and Meghan chose to quit the Royal Family and move to the USA. However, a few readers expressed doubt that William would follow through, with Nancy Brown writing, 'Hope so, but does he have the bottle. Maybe not!'

The poll reflects a broader frustration with Harry's decision to step back from royal life while retaining certain privileges. Many readers agreed that William would have no choice but to strip the titles, while some highlighted the potential impact on the royal family's unity.
